Hazel Irvine presents live coverage of the final round of the Masters from Augusta.
This time in 2015, Jordan Spieth equalled the lowest winning score in Masters history en route to claiming his first major.
The 21-year-old American, second on his debut a year previously, kept his nerve on the final day to end 18 under and take victory ahead of England's Justin Rose and three-time champion Phil Mickelson, who finished joint second.
Spieth's weekend to remember saw him equal Tiger Woods's winning score of 18 under from 1997.

A look back at the drama from the 80th Masters, which saw England's Danny Willett win his first major by three shots, capitalising on a dramatic collapse by 2015 Masters champion Jordan Spieth.

Hazel Irvine, Ken Brown, Paul Azinger and Peter Alliss look ahead to the 2017 Masters, the first major of the year, with the world's greatest golfers battling it out for arguably the sport's biggest prize - the illustrious green jacket. In 2016 Englishman Danny Willett was the surprise winner, becoming the first British champion since Sir Nick Faldo in 1996. Willett might struggle to retain his title against newly crowned world number one Dustin Johnson and the man looking to complete his career Grand Slam, Northern Irishman Rory McIlroy.

Eilidh Barbour presents live third-round action from Augusta as the world's greatest golfers battle not only each other but the world-famous and historied course.
12 months ago England's Justin Rose birdied five of the final seven holes en route to superb round of 67, which saw him end the day as joint leader alongside Spaniard Sergio Garcia at -6. Jordan Speith, Lee Westwood and Charl Schwartzel all shot rounds of 68 to get themselves into contention. However Charlie Hoffman and former champion Phil Mickelson were amongst the men to fall foul of Augusta's many hazards to drop down the leaderboard.

Eilidh Barbour introduces live final-round coverage of the 82nd Masters from the world famous Augusta National Golf Club with the famous green jacket tantalisingly close for those towards the top of the leaderboard.
Last year it was Spaniard and European Ryder Cup hero Sergio Garcia who claimed the prize for the first time in his career. He beat playing partner Justin Rose in a play-off after both men shot a three-under-par 69 on a thrilling final day action.

Warm up for the first major of the golf calendar by revisiting the highs and lows at Augusta in 2021, when Hideki Matsuyama became the first male Japanese golfer to win the green jacket.
Matsuyama triumphed by just one shot ahead of American Will Zalatoris in a tournament that was also memorable for spectators returning in reduced numbers following the restrictions of the Covid-19 pandemic.
